Descrição

In a corporate landscape where teamwork and cooperation play crucial roles, managers often find themselves grappling with the complexities of dysfunctional employees. Laurence Miller delves deep into this pressing issue, offering insightful strategies for navigating challenging personalities. With a keen understanding of human behavior, the author elucidates the factors that contribute to workplace dysfunction, enabling managers to differentiate between various types of difficult employees.

Through a blend of psychological insights and practical advice, the book guides managers in recognizing patterns of behavior that can disrupt productivity while also fostering a more cohesive working environment. It explores techniques for addressing conflict and enhancing communication, emphasizing the importance of empathy and understanding in leadership.

As managers face the daily challenges of their roles, this resource empowers them to transform difficult situations into opportunities for growth. By learning to manage dysfunction effectively, they can cultivate a more harmonious workplace, leading both employees and teams towards success.
